The Ultrastructure and Elemental Composition in Eggshell of The Tibetan Eared-Pheasant,Crossoptilon harmani

  • By scanning electron microscopy and inductively couple plasma spectrometry (ICP),the ultrastructure and elemental composition of the eggshell of Tibetan Eared-pheasant (Crossoptilon harmani) have been investigated.The average thickness of the surface layer of crystals,the palisade and cone layer and the eggshell membrane are 9.3 μm,307.1 μm and 64.6 μm respectively,Their proportions to the total thickness of the eggshell 2.4%,80.6% and 17% respectively.There are many vesicular holes in palisade layer,and physiological significance such structure may be of significant to air exchange.The shape of eggshell pore on the surface layer of crystals is circle or ellipsis or irregular square.The fracture surface of eggshell pore is funneled-shape.Some granules fill in the upper part of the eggshell pore.The contents of 21 elements in the eggshell is presented in this paper.
